G7 Report: Quantum Computing Threat Looms
The G7 cybersecurity working group has put out a report saying quantum computing is not just a security problem but an economic one too for public and private organizations. Its message is blunt: move to post-quantum cryptography (PQC) now. And the report says this shift could take years. That timing matters, because attackers are already gathering encrypted data and stashing it away, waiting for quantum computers strong enough to crack it later.
Digital Signature Risk and Blockchain Relevance
Quantum computing could also smash digital signatures. That opens the door to identity theft and leaves enterprises, along with their supply chains, exposed. The report does not mention cryptocurrencies. Still, the same kind of public-key cryptography is used in blockchain wallets and in transaction authorization. Right now, quantum computers cannot break Bitcoin's cryptography, but developers are weighing post-quantum proposals such as BIP-360. Ethereum researchers are preparing to replace several cryptographic components used by accounts, validators, and applications. And the Solana Foundation has already tested post-quantum signatures on testnet and launched optional hash-based vaults.
G7 Calls for Government Support
The G7 working group is also pressing governments to back research, public-private partnerships, and national PQC strategies.
